Udaipur Tailor Murder: Curfew relaxed for 4 hours, 10 hours relief on Sunday

The district administration here on Saturday relaxed for four hours the curfew imposed in seven police station areas in view of the killing of a tailor, officials said. However, mobile internet services remained suspended.

The curfew will be relaxed by 10 hours on Sunday as the situation gradually returns to normal, officials said. Two men killed Kanhaiya Lal, a tailor, with a knife at his shop in Dhan Mandi area here on Tuesday to avenge the “insult to Islam”.

After the incident, curfew was imposed in the areas bordering seven police station areas – Dhan Mandi, Ghanta Ghar, Hathi Pol, Amba Mata, Suraj Pol, Bhupalpura and Savina. Udaipur Collector Tara Chand Meena said, “Curfew has been relaxed in the city from 12 noon to 4 pm today. Relaxation will be given from 8 am to 6 am on Sunday.”

Official sources said the decision to relax the curfew was taken after reviewing the situation. He said that with the peaceful conduct of Friday’s Jagannath Rath Yatra, which was attended by thousands, the administration decided to relax the curfew on Saturday.

Four people have been arrested in connection with Lal’s murder.
